Underrated: Pixies The Pixies are often cited as one of the biggest influences in modern alternative rock, yet somehow are never listed amongst the big boys. Bands like Radiohead, Nirvana (& countless more) often cite them as being amongst the best, yet it's very, very rare I see them charting in anyones top 10s. In my opinion their small back catalogue more than matches any other band out there. 'Surfer Rosa' and 'Doolittle' are often described as classics, however 'Bossanova' and 'Trompe Le Monde' are often ignored when really they're just as good. I'd even argue 'Trompe Le Monde' is better than 'Surfer Rosa', and 'Doolittle' is the only album I can safely say I think is better than Oasis's 'Definitely Maybe'. Easily my favourite band. Bonus 'Somewhat Interesting Oasis Fact': Noel Gallagher came up with the name 'Champagne Supernova' whilst drinking champagne and listening to the Pixies 3rd LP 'Bossanova' at the same time. True story. Apparently.
